Austin Hill Surpasses Dale Earnhardt Jr.’s Superspeedway Record: The New King of NASCAR?

Austin Hill, a titan in the world of NASCAR, has been carving a niche for himself, one lap at a time. Since he was just six, he’s been fostering an indomitable spirit and a relentless drive for victory. Now, his name echoes not only in the halls of Richard Childress Racing but across the entire NASCAR Xfinity Series. His recent triumph at Atlanta Motor Speedway is just another testament to his talent. It’s not just a victory, but a declaration that he’s now a part of the annals of NASCAR history.

This victory, however, has a special significance. It has placed Hill in a unique position, one that brings him face to face with the legendary Earnhardt legacy. Hill’s Atlanta Motor Speedway victory saw him pacing 146 of 163 laps, marking his third consecutive win at the venue. But the highlight of this race was Hill surpassing Dale Earnhardt Jr.’s record for the most laps led on superspeedways in Xfinity history. With a tally of 734 laps to Earnhardt’s 691, Hill has demonstrated his prowess in draft-heavy racing.

The rapid ascension of Hill in the superspeedway racing realm is no fluke. His aggressive, yet calculated approach has set him apart at iconic tracks like Atlanta, Daytona, and Talladega. Notably, his five career Xfinity wins at Atlanta now equate to a record previously held by Kevin Harvick. This accomplishment is a clear indication of Hill’s ability to control the draft and outperform his competitors.

Even Dale Earnhardt Jr., on his Dirty Air podcast, couldn’t help but acknowledge Hill’s extraordinary talent. He lauded Hill’s innate racing instincts and his knack for keeping his foot on the gas, not overthinking his maneuvers. Earnhardt Jr. further noted Hill’s strategic dominance in the draft, a trait he believes sets Hill apart. He warned his own drivers about aiding Hill, stating that pushing Hill into the lead essentially meant settling for the second place.

Hill’s recent triumph at Atlanta has solidified his standing as a leading force in the Xfinity Series. He shares the record of eight total superspeedway wins with Dale Jr and Tony Stewart, reinforcing Richard Childress Racing’s dominance on drafting tracks. As the season unfolds, the pressing question isn’t whether Hill can continue his superspeedway dominance, but who, if anyone, can bring his winning streak to a halt.

The NASCAR Xfinity Series now moves to Circuit of The Americas (COTA) for the upcoming Focused Health 250. Last year, at this very venue, Hill suffered a setback when Shane van Gisbergen nudged him on the final lap, pushing him to a disappointing second-place finish. However, Hill is no stranger to adversity and is known for his ability to bounce back. His aggressive, yet controlled driving style coupled with his adaptability makes him a formidable competitor at COTA.

As the fans gear up for another adrenaline-fueled race, all eyes will be on Austin Hill. Will he be able to secure the victory that eluded him last year at COTA? Or will another unexpected twist keep him from the top spot? Stay tuned for a thrilling race as Hill guns for redemption at the Focused Health 250.
